gpt4 book ai didi

git - 在 Github 中重新附加一个 "Detached"分支?

转载 作者:太空狗 更新时间:2023-10-29 13:20:01 26 4
gpt4 key购买 nike

我想知道是否有办法在 GitHub 中重新附加一个“分离的”存储库?

事件顺序:

  1. 从我所属的组织 fork 了一个私有(private)仓库
  2. 父级、私有(private)存储库公开
  3. 我也公开了我的 fork 存储库(或收费)
  4. 现在,当我希望提交 pull 请求并 merge 一些更改时,我注意到我的复刻与父存储库 (see this explanation and confirmation as to why)“分离”

有没有希望“重新连接”这个 fork ?或者我重命名我的存储库,再次 fork ,然后复制代码?

欢迎提出任何建议。

最佳答案

感谢@saeedgnu 优雅而完美的建议。解决方案是:

  1. 确保从个人的、独立的 fork GitHub 存储库中 pull 和更新本地 git 存储库
  2. 删除个人的、分离的 GitHub 存储库
  3. 在 GitHub 上重新 fork 存储库
  4. 关键:本地 git 存储库仍然指向正确的 GitHub 存储库。它具有来自您现已删除的分离 GitHub 分支的当前代码,因此您可以推送更改(并继续提交 pull 请求),就像什么都没有发生过一样!

呸。避免了危机。

关于git - 在 Github 中重新附加一个 "Detached"分支?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36225381/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com